3b37488eee fix: keep node context menu overflow visible when content fits (#12035)
## Summary

Stops the Shape submenu (and any other PrimeVue nested submenu) from
being clipped behind the node context menu when the menu fits in the
viewport.

## Changes

- **What**: `constrainMenuHeight` in `NodeContextMenu.vue` now applies
`max-height` + `overflow-y: auto` to the root `<ul>` only when
`scrollHeight > availableHeight`. The common case keeps `overflow:
visible`.
- Added `browser_tests/tests/nodeContextMenuShapeSubmenu.spec.ts`
regression spec.

## Review Focus

Root cause: setting only `overflow-y: auto` on a `<ul>` coerces
`overflow-x` to a non-visible value per CSS spec (`If one of
overflow-x/overflow-y is visible and the other isn't, the visible value
is computed as auto`). PrimeVue `ContextMenuSub` renders submenus
in-tree as a nested `<ul>` with `position: absolute; left: 100%`, so the
implicit horizontal clip hides them entirely.

The pre-existing overflow scenario (#10824 / #10854) is unchanged — when
the menu actually overflows, the clamp still applies and
`nodeContextMenuOverflow.spec.ts` continues to verify scroll. Submenu
clipping in that overflow case is a known limitation, not introduced by
this PR.

fc7e6a0935 fix(terminal): resync logs console on backend reconnect (#12270)
## Summary

When the built-in logs terminal stayed open during a backend restart,
the buffer froze on pre-restart entries and live log streaming silently
stopped — only closing and reopening the panel resynced. Listen for the
api `reconnected` event and rebuild the terminal contents the same way a
fresh open would.

## Changes

- **What**:
- Extract `useLogsTerminal` composable. The SFC is now a thin shell
holding `terminal: shallowRef<Terminal>` and forwarding to the
composable, so `onMounted`/`onScopeDispose` no longer rely on the
child's emit callback timing.
- Subscribe to `api`'s `reconnected` event via `useEventListener`,
registered synchronously before any awaits. On reconnect:
`terminal.reset()` → refetch raw logs → `scrollToBottom()` →
`subscribeLogs(true)` (the backend loses the per-client subscription on
restart, so re-subscribe is required for live streaming to resume).
- Wrap in-flight resync/mount fetches in AbortControllers. Overlapping
reconnects abort the prior resync, and unmount mid-fetch suppresses
writes to the disposed xterm.
- Hide BaseTerminal whenever `errorMessage` is set so the error layout
doesn't expose an empty xterm container behind the message;
`loading=false` after both load failure and resync success so a later
successful reconnect can clear a stuck spinner.
- Migrate the load/resync error strings to vue-i18n
(`logsTerminal.loadError`, `logsTerminal.resyncError`).

## Review Focus

- **Re-subscribe is the non-obvious half of the fix** — without it, even
after the WebSocket reconnects the backend never resumes streaming logs
to this client because its subscription state was wiped on restart. The
visible "stale buffer" is only one symptom; the silent "no new logs"
symptom needed the explicit `subscribeLogs(true)` re-call in resync.
- `terminal.reset()` lives after a successful raw-logs fetch (not
before) so a failed resync leaves the prior buffer visible instead of
blanking it; resync errors surface via the same inline error message the
mount path uses.
- 8 unit tests around the composable: mount + subscribe, resync ordering
(reset → write → scroll → subscribe via `invocationCallOrder`),
in-flight resync abort on double reconnect, resync error surfacing,
mount-failure-then-recovery, unmount-mid-fetch terminal-write
suppression, listener cleanup on unmount.
- 2 E2E tests using `ws.close()` on the proxied WebSocket as the
reconnect trigger and `subscribeLogs` HTTP fetch count as the sync point
(same pattern as `wsReconnectStaleJob.spec.ts`). Red-checked: disabling
the `reconnected` listener fails exactly the two new tests, all 8
pre-existing tests stay green.

25c2d828c0 test: enable vitest/consistent-each-for and migrate .each → .for (#12161)
*PR Created by the Glary-Bot Agent*

---

Enables the oxlint rule `vitest/consistent-each-for` (configured to
prefer `.for` for `test`, `it`, `describe`, and `suite`) and migrates
every `.each` parameterized test in the repo to `.for`. Using `.for`
avoids accidentally splatting tuple elements into separate callback
arguments and exposes `TestContext` as the second callback argument.

The first commit covers the 38 lint-detected files (88 callsites):
renames `.each` → `.for` and updates callback signatures to destructure
when the data is an array of tuples (objects/primitives already work
unchanged with `.for`).

The follow-up commit addresses code review feedback: oxlint's rule does
not recognize `test.each` on extended test bases
(`baseTest.extend(...)`) and skips files in `ignorePatterns`
(`src/extensions/core/*`). These were converted manually so the policy
is uniform across the codebase.

## Verification

- `node_modules/.bin/oxlint src` — 0 errors, 0 `consistent-each-for`
violations
- `pnpm typecheck` — passes
- `pnpm test:unit` — all modified test files pass; pre-existing
environmental flakes (`GraphView.test.ts`, `ColorWidget.test.ts`, etc.,
unchanged here and flaky on `main` in this sandbox) are unrelated
- `pnpm lint` / `pnpm knip` — clean
- Manual verification: 362 tests across 6 representative converted
suites re-run in an interactive shell — all passing

Manual UI verification (Playwright/screenshots) is not applicable:
changes are test-file-only refactors with no production runtime or UI
behavior change.

## Notes on `.for` semantics

- Array-of-tuples (`[[a, b], ...]`) passes the tuple as a single arg, so
callbacks were changed from `(a, b) => …` to `([a, b]) => …`.
- Array-of-objects (`[{a}, …]`) already used destructuring — unchanged.
- Array-of-primitives (`['a', …]`) — callback signature unchanged.
- A handful of complex cases use a small `type Case = [...]` alias plus
`it.for<Case>([...])` to preserve tuple inference where TS narrowed
unions otherwise broke parameter types.

7b59c561ff fix(load3d): update renderer pixel ratio on canvas zoom to fix LOD resolution (#11734)
## Summary

Preview 3D and Animation nodes were stuck at the LOD from initial page
load because CSS `scale3d` transforms don't affect
`clientWidth`/`clientHeight` — `handleResize()` always received
layout-space dimensions regardless of zoom level. This fix passes
`ds.scale` as the renderer pixel ratio so the 3D scene renders at the
correct visual resolution when the graph is zoomed in or out.

## Changes

- **What**: In `Load3d.handleResize()`, call
`renderer.setPixelRatio(ds.scale)` before `setSize` so pixel density
scales with canvas zoom. A `getZoomScale` callback is threaded through
`Load3DOptions` → `Load3d` constructor → `handleResize`. In `useLoad3d`,
a watcher on `canvasStore.appScalePercentage` triggers `handleResize`
whenever the zoom level changes.
- **What**: Fix `SceneManager.captureScene()` to save and restore the
renderer's logical size and pixel ratio around capture, so exact-pixel
output is unaffected by the current zoom state.

## Review Focus

- `handleResize` now calls `setPixelRatio` before `setSize`. Three.js
renders at `logicalWidth × pixelRatio` physical pixels while CSS
displays it at `logicalWidth` CSS pixels — this is the standard pattern
for HiDPI but here used to match the visual zoom level.
- `captureScene` must reset `pixelRatio` to 1 so `setSize(w, h)`
produces exactly `w×h` pixel output. It saves and restores both logical
size and pixel ratio via `renderer.getSize()` /
`renderer.getPixelRatio()`.
- The zoom watcher is guarded with `getActivePinia()` to avoid errors in
unit tests and non-Pinia contexts.

b232831441 fix: stop duplicate node creation when dropping image on Vue nodes (#11541)
## Summary
handleDrop checked `handled === true` to gate stopPropagation, but
onDragDrop from useNodeDragAndDrop is async and always returns a
Promise, so the check never matched. The drop then bubbled to the
document handler in app.ts and spawned a new LoadImage node in addition
to the one that accepted the drop.

Updated onDragDrop to take an optional claimEvent flag — when true, it
calls preventDefault()/stopPropagation() synchronously inside the
handler, only after the sync acceptance check passes (valid files /
same-origin URI), and before any await.
The Vue node now just calls await node.onDragDrop(event, true).
Rejected payloads (cross-origin URI, files filtered out, no valid files)
skip the claim and bubble to the document fallback as before. The
remaining edge case is async URI fetch failures, which we can't
sync-detect without speculatively claiming.

71ca582325 fix: reset file input value after selection to allow same-file reupload (#11417)
*PR Created by the Glary-Bot Agent*

---

## Summary

Fixes the "choose video to upload" button becoming unresponsive after
running a workflow with a subgraph a few times.

**Root cause**: The detached input element in `useNodeFileInput` never
resets its `value`. The browser's `onchange` only fires when the value
*changes* — re-selecting the same file silently drops the event. A page
refresh recreates the input with an empty value, which is why refreshing
fixes it.

## Changes

- `useNodeFileInput.ts`: Reset `fileInput.value` before invoking
callbacks so value is cleared even if a callback throws
- `useNodeDragAndDrop.ts`: Add `onRemoved` cleanup for installed
handlers (only clears own handlers; preserves replacements from
extensions)
- `useNodePaste.ts`: Add `onRemoved` cleanup for installed `pasteFiles`
handler (same reference-safe pattern)
- 3 new colocated test files with 26 test cases covering all branches

## Codebase Audit

Audited all 11 file upload implementations across the codebase. Found 5
using the ghost/virtual input pattern — 3 with the same missing
value-reset bug:
- `useNodeFileInput.ts` — fixed in this PR
- `scripts/utils.ts` (`uploadFile()`) — one-shot pattern, lower risk
- `extensions/core/load3d.ts` — partial reset only

The 4 Vue component implementations already reset correctly.

## Future Work

VueUse `useFileDialog` composable handles same-file reselection via
`reset: true` and provides automatic lifecycle cleanup. A follow-up PR
could migrate the ghost input patterns for a centralized solution.
